Far Cry 6 is the latest chapter of the action-packed, first-person shooter saga. It reaches its sixth edition, promising to reach the same high levels of excitement and action as its predecessors.
With an official release date now announced (7th October 2021), fans of the franchise can already start to pre-order the game from various outlets.

Far Cry 6 Pre-order Pricing
As far as pricing goes, we should expect the following for the various different versions of the game:
Far Cry 6 PC Prices
Standard Edition: £49.99
Gold Edition: £83.99
Ultimate Edition: £99.99 (currently £91.99)
Collector’s Edition: £179.99
Far Cry 6 PS5 Prices
Standard Edition: £59.99
Gold Edition: £84.99
Ultimate Edition: £99.99
Collector’s Edition: £179.99
Far Cry 6 PS4 Prices
Standard Edition: £59.99
Gold Edition: £84.99
Ultimate Edition: £99.99
Collector’s Edition: £179.99
Far Cry 6 Xbox One/Series X Prices
Standard Edition: £59.99
Gold Edition: £84.99
Ultimate Edition: £99.99
Collector’s Edition: £179.99
